Step 5. From the back of the rack, install a bracket on the outside of each rail, using two screws per bracket. Be sure to use the upper screw holes on each bracket. Put the screws in the seventh and eighth square holes—counting away from yourself—in each rail. Do not tighten the screws. These brackets—referred to as “bracket 3” and “bracket 4” in these steps—will secure the back of the switch. The following figure shows the rack with these two brackets installed.
